firewalld заблокировал сеть

Ответить
Аватара пользователя
maxim
Сообщения: 81
Зарегистрирован: 31 окт 2022, 13:29
Operating system: ROSA Linux 13 Plasma6

firewalld заблокировал сеть

Сообщение maxim »

Обновился вчера и уже вечером увидел, что не доступны контейнеры запущенные в docker.
Стал разбираться что случилось, в логах увидел следующее:

Код: Выделить всё

ERROR: UNKNOWN_INTERFACE: 'virbr0' is not in any zone firewalld
Самое интересное, что firewalld я никогда не устанавливал, я использую firehol.

Начал искать, когда он установился:

Код: Выделить всё


# dnf history info 344
Идентификатор транзакции: 344
Время начала   : Вт 17 фев 2026 14:13:55
Начало rpmdb   : 50925089320c736f4eefd149f4babdcd4eced3b7
Время окончания       : Вт 17 фев 2026 14:16:26 (151 секунд)
Конец rpmdb    : 1f54b2a038979abde20a97bcedc3484fba5390cc
Пользователь   :
Код возврата   : Успешно
Выпускаемая версия     : 13
Команда   : --refresh distrosync --allowerasing
Комментарий        :
Пакеты изменены:

    Upgrade       firewalld-2.3.2-1.noarch                                   @mirror-rosa-x86_64-main
    Upgraded      firewalld-2.3.0-1.noarch                                   @@System
    Upgrade       firewalld-filesystem-2.3.2-1.noarch                        @mirror-rosa-x86_64-main
    Upgraded      firewalld-filesystem-2.3.0-1.noarch                        @@System
Тут он обновился и видимо эти обновы и заблокировали сеть.

А вот когда он установился:

Код: Выделить всё

# dnf history info 342
Идентификатор транзакции: 342
Время начала   : Пн 09 фев 2026 09:23:10
Начало rpmdb   : a20e2131959588242b5d94ff2200ac46b9e55970
Время окончания       : Пн 09 фев 2026 09:26:47 (217 секунд)
Конец rpmdb    : 66012f217686a6166bc8b9713b8e8a5b7b13181f
Пользователь   :
Код возврата   : Успешно
Выпускаемая версия     : 13
Команда   : --refresh distrosync --allowerasing
Комментарий        :
Пакеты изменены:

    Установка     firewalld-2.3.0-1.noarch                                  @mirror-rosa-x86_64-main
    Установка     firewalld-filesystem-2.3.0-1.noarch                       @mirror-rosa-x86_64-main
При удалении видно, что скорей всего его притащил plasma5-firewall :

Код: Выделить всё

# dnf rm firewalld
Зависимости разрешены.
===========================================================================================================================================================================
 Пакет                                        Архитектура                    Версия                              Репозиторий                                         Размер
===========================================================================================================================================================================
Удаление:
 firewalld                                    noarch                         2.3.2-1                             @mirror-rosa-x86_64-main                            2.0 M
Удаление зависимых пакетов:
 plasma5-firewall                             x86_64                         5.27.12-2                           @mirror-rosa-x86_64-contrib                         1.0 M
Удаление неиспользуемых зависимостей:
 firewalld-filesystem                         noarch                         2.3.2-1                             @mirror-rosa-x86_64-main                            239
 python3-decorator                            noarch                         5.1.1-1                             @mirror-rosa-x86_64-main                             71 k
 python3-firewall                             noarch                         2.3.2-1                             @mirror-rosa-x86_64-main                            3.1 M
 python3-nftables                             x86_64                         1.1.0-2                             @mirror-rosa-x86_64-main                             46 k
 python3-slip                                 noarch                         0.6.5-2                             @mirror-rosa-x86_64-main                             74 k
 python3-slip-dbus                            noarch                         0.6.5-2                             @mirror-rosa-x86_64-main                             87 k

Результат транзакции
===========================================================================================================================================================================
Удаление  8 Пакетов
Удаление пакета plasma5-firewall вернуло всё в норму.
Будьте внимательны!
Аватара пользователя
VictorR2007
Сообщения: 8144
Зарегистрирован: 12 сен 2011, 13:00
Operating system: ROSA 2023.1

Re: firewalld заблокировал сеть

Сообщение VictorR2007 »

А вы не проверяли состояние брандмауэра?
Смотрю вывод ваших обновлений.
Там есть про обновление firewalld-2.3.0-1.
Версия firewalld-2.3.0-1 была по умолчанию включена.
Чтобы не возникало таких случаев, как у вас, его по умолчанию сделали отключеным
в версии firewalld-2.3.0-2.
Но если у вас он уже был включен, то он так и остался включенным.
И уже после отключения обновили его до версии firewalld-2.3.2.
Так что сейчас он должен быть выключенным при установке пакета plasma5-firewall.
Вот установил его.
Надеюсь что в таком виде он ничего не блокирует.
Вложения
Снимок экрана_20260222_110606.jpeg
Ответить

Вернуться в «Программы РОСА десктоп»